Referred to by its creators as "the duct tape of the Internet," Perl is a flexible and powerful programming language that can handle many tasks, from system administration to web programming to complex object-oriented systems.
Perl is one of the most widely used languages to write CGI (Common Gateway Interface) applications to produce sophisticated and interactive pages for websites.
